Rhea-AI Filing Summary

American Outdoor Brands (NASDAQ:AOUT) filed a Form 8-K covering Items 2.02 & 7.01. The company is furnishing—not filing—a transcript (Exhibit 99.1) from its June 26 conference call that reviewed fourth-quarter and full-year fiscal 2025 results. No financial metrics appear in the 8-K itself; investors must consult the transcript or webcast replay posted on aob.com for details. Management invoked safe-harbor language and highlighted risk factors ranging from supply-chain disruptions and consumer-spending swings to acquisition integration and activist activity. Exhibit 104 contains the Inline XBRL cover page. The disclosure is intended to satisfy Regulation FD and does not trigger Section 18 liability.

Item 2.02 Results of Operations and Financial Condition.
As described in Item 7.01, we are furnishing this Current Report on Form 8-K in connection with the disclosure of information during a conference call and webcast on June 26, 2025 discussing our fourth quarter and full year fiscal 2025 financial results. The disclosure provided in Item 7.01 of this Current Report on Form 8-K is hereby incorporated by reference into this Item 2.02.
The information in this Current Report on Form 8-K (including the exhibit) is furnished pursuant to Item 2.02 and shall not be deemed to be “filed” for the purpose of Section 18 of the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, as amended, or the Exchange Act, or otherwise subject to the liabilities of that section.
Item 7.01 Regulation FD Disclosure.
We are furnishing this Current Report on Form 8-K in connection with the disclosure of information during a conference call and webcast on June 26, 2025 discussing our fourth quarter and full year fiscal 2025 financial results. The transcript of the conference call and webcast is included as Exhibit 99.1 to this Current Report on Form 8-K.
The information in this Current Report on Form 8-K (including Exhibit 99.1) is furnished pursuant to Item 7.01 and shall not be deemed to be “filed” for the purpose of Section 18 of the Exchange Act of 1934, as amended, or otherwise subject to the liabilities of that section. This Current Report on Form 8-K will not be deemed an admission as to the materiality of any information in the Current Report on Form 8-K that is required to be disclosed solely by Regulation FD.
The text included with this Current Report on Form 8-K and the replay of the conference call and webcast on June 26, 2025 is available on our website located at aob.com, although we reserve the right to discontinue that availability at any time.

FAQ

Where can investors find AOUT's FY25 Q4 and full-year results?

The detailed results are in Exhibit 99.1—the transcript of the June 26 earnings call—and on the investor section of aob.com.

Does the 8-K include AOUT's actual revenue or EPS figures for FY25?

No. The 8-K body contains no financial metrics; investors must review the furnished transcript for specific numbers.

Why does AOUT state the information is 'furnished' and not 'filed'?

Classifying the data as furnished under Items 2.02 and 7.01 avoids Section 18 liability while meeting Regulation FD disclosure rules.

What exhibit accompanies AOUT's 8-K filing dated June 27 2025?

Exhibit 99.1 is the full transcript of the June 26 2025 conference call; Exhibit 104 is the Inline XBRL cover-page data file.
